Overview

In today’s rapidly evolving regulatory landscape, understanding compliance risk and effective management strategies is crucial for businesses to thrive and maintain integrity. This course, “Compliance Risk and Management,” is design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of compliance risks, the frameworks used to manage these risks, and the impact of regulatory requirements on organizations. Participants will explore the fundamentals of compliance, including key principles, regulatory bodies, and the importance of compliance in various industries. The course will delve into risk assessment, mitigation strategies, and the development of compliance programs tailored to specific business needs. By analyzing real-world case studies and engaging in interactive discussions, learners will gain practical insights into identifying, assessing, and managing compliance risks. Additionally, the course will cover the roles and responsibilities of compliance officers, the significance of corporate governance, and the ethical considerations involved in compliance management. This course is ideal for professionals seeking to enhance their knowledge of compliance risk, improve their ability to develop robust compliance programs, and ensure their organizations remain compliant with relevant laws and regulations.
